Welcome to GraphLattice, Torvane's dependency graph visualizer. Clone the repo, run `make bootstrap`, then `make serve`. The renderer pulls edge data from the metadata store every 30 seconds; don't bypass the cache layer. Ask Priya in #lattice-dev before touching the resolver. To run locally you'll need read access to the metadata database, using the connection string below.

primary connection of yagep-kahip = redis://giliel_svc:zYiKsLL2PLpfPL@db-348f.xolmarsys.corp:5432/fenwyn

Ticket #— Floor 9 Opening Prep, Brindlemoor House

Hi facilities folks, Floor 9 opens to staff next Monday and we need a few things squared away before then. Lift access is live, but the two side doors by the kitchenette are still on the old lock config — please reprogram them before Friday. Also, signage for the quiet rooms hasn't arrived, so pop up the temporary printed ones for now. Until the badge readers sync, the interim door code for Floor 9 is below.

door code, bajop-bajog: bdg-DSWAC-43621

## Onboarding: Fleet Fuel-Usage Report Pipeline

Welcome to the Roadlark analytics team. The weekly fuel-usage report aggregates telemetry from every vehicle in the Halverton depot fleet and publishes a signed summary to the operations portal. Accuracy matters here: dispatch budgets depend on these numbers, so always run the reconciliation script against the prior week before publishing. Once the figures reconcile and the reviewer approves, the report bundle must be signed so the portal accepts it. Sign it with the pipeline key below.

rollout seal: bky9_aBG1gvAyU

Test plan: fd-leak hunt in the Brindlewick ingest daemon. Steps: run the soak harness for six hours with upload churn enabled, sample /proc fd counts every five minutes, and diff against the baseline from build 112. Flag any monotonic growth over 2%. To pull leak-counter metrics from the Harrowgate probe endpoint, authenticate with the bearer token below.

session JWT of yawep-yawep = eyJhbGciOiJIUzI1NiIsInR5cCI6IkpXVCJ9.eyJzdWIiOiI3pWF3_In0.aXYsHiog